  6. Apr 26, 2024 · Sid Caesar was an American comedian and actor with a $10 million net worth. On September 8, 1922, in Yonkers, New York, Sid Caesar was born Isaac Sidney Caesar. Sid Caesar is best known for anchoring “Your Show of Shows” and “Caesar’s Hour,” two groundbreaking television series.

  8. 6 days ago · A pioneer of sketch comedy, Sid Caesar was best known as the creator and star of Your Show of Shows and Caesar's Hour, which introduced a new format for television humor. Caesar's gift for physical comedy, impressions, and improvisation made him an influential figure in the world of comedy.
